Notes before you end the Omega expedition and return to your main save

Here’s my notes on this. I saw different posts covering parts of this, but I want to try and capture them all here for some traveler out there.

Before you End the Expedition:

  • Note that you’ve accumulated a lot of quicksilver currency. You can use this at the vendor near the floating mission computer to unlock cool stuff. Quicksilver is the hardest currency to find, so you don’t want to waste it. Any items you unlock with Quicksilver, can be reclaimed at the same vendor freely on any other save file.
  • Note that each tier of the Omega expedition has an optional achievement for scanning aliens, minerals, and plants on each Rendezvous planet. If you missed these and want to finish them and you can’t remember where those planets are, don’t worry, all you need to do is visit the portal in a space station and view the previous space stations you’ve visited. You’ll notice that some of these will have extra text on them like (Rendezvous #1). That will take you to the star where the Rendezvous planet is. Look for a lot of bases which are the purple icons you see on the planet surface from space. That should get you on the right planet.

And now assuming you really are ready to finish:

  • Did you transfer important tech upgrades from your suit/multitool/ship?
    • Then make sure you transfer it back. Your main save does not have them now. You need to send them back!
  • Transfer any other items back that you want to keep. If you’re new to New Man’s Sky, I’d suggest keeping rare eggs you received, Good S-Class upgrades you need, and especially any upgrade modules for your freighter (like +1 inventory to freighter, because freighter stuff is hard to find.
  • When you arrive back in your main save, anything you stored back in the Expedition terminal on the Anomaly will be waiting for you, kind of like a locker.

Play past expeditions today(only on pc, sorry console people)

One question that I’ve seen asked quite often is if it is possible to play past expeditions, and people usually answer that aside from the four redux expeditions at the end of the year, you can’t, officially, that is the only way. However, there is a very easy and safe workaround that allows you to play any expedition at any time.

The data of all the past expeditions is still in the game, but these expeditions can no longer be accessed. However, there’s a file named SEASON_DATA_CACHE.json that controls the start and end dates of the expeditions, the milestones, the rewards, and a bit more. By editing this file, you can make these expeditions playable again without messing with the actual game files or your save file. JSON files are a bit hard to read and understand at first, but someone on github has already modified the file for all past expeditions, even accounting for the inventory system change in the Waypoint update. It’s literally just drag and drop; just make sure to read the readme files first, there’s a very good tutorial and notes about the expeditions, like bugs and possible workarounds.
